Across TCGA cell cohorts, POC5 RNA expression is significantly associated with the go_rna of many other GO terms, with 3,832 significant associations in total. BLOOD_Leukemia sh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ible POC5-associated GO terms across cancer lineages are Centriole elongation, Regulation of centriole elongation, and Nuclear envelope organization. Each is linked with POC5 in more than 16 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both POC5-to-partner and partner-to-POC5 results are reported.
